Subject: [PATCH 4/4] dsmark:  checkpatch warning cleanup
Date: Sun, 20 Jan 2008 13:25:36 -0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20080120132536.6f29edda@deepthought>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20080120131008.2039a35d@deepthought>

Get rid of all style things checkpatch warns about, indentation
and whitespace.

Signed-off-by: Stephen Hemminger <shemminger@vyatta.com>

--- a/net/sched/sch_dsmark.c	2008-01-20 13:23:34.000000000 -0800
+++ b/net/sched/sch_dsmark.c	2008-01-20 13:24:45.000000000 -0800
